生活碎片
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
18、Docker开发与贡献指南
本文详细介绍了Docker项目的开发与贡献流程,涵盖使用开发二进制文件、运行测试、交互式开发环境搭建、提交拉取请求的规范、开发者证书(DCO)要求以及维护者审查机制。通过示例场景和流程图,帮助开发者快速上手并遵循社区标准,高效参与Docker开源项目贡献。原创 2025-10-02 06:57:42 · 33 阅读 · 0 评论 -
17、Docker API使用与开发环境搭建全攻略
本文详细介绍了Docker API的安全配置与开发环境搭建全过程。内容涵盖使用SSL/TLS证书保护Docker Engine API通信、生成CA及客户端/服务器证书、配置Docker守护进程与客户端认证,并提供了完整的开发环境搭建步骤,包括源码检出、依赖安装、二进制构建与测试。同时包含常见问题排查方法和流程图解,帮助开发者安全高效地使用Docker API并参与Docker项目贡献。原创 2025-10-01 11:53:55 · 31 阅读 · 0 评论 -
16、使用 Docker API 指南
本文详细介绍了如何使用Docker Engine API进行容器和镜像的自动化管理,涵盖本地与远程连接配置、基础API测试、镜像与容器操作、应用程序集成改进,以及通过TLS/SSL证书为API添加安全认证的完整流程。通过实际命令示例和Ruby代码集成,帮助开发者高效、安全地实现Docker自动化集成。原创 2025-09-30 14:08:29 · 38 阅读 · 0 评论 -
15、Docker 编排、服务发现及 API 使用指南
本文深入介绍了Docker在分布式应用中的服务发现机制、Docker Swarm集群的安装与配置、服务的创建与扩展,以及如何通过API实现自动化管理和安全通信。涵盖了Swarm节点管理、复制与全局服务、主流编排工具对比,并详细演示了Docker API的使用方法及TLS安全认证配置,帮助开发者高效构建和管理容器化应用。原创 2025-09-29 10:39:29 · 26 阅读 · 0 评论 -
14、Docker 中 Consul 集群搭建与分布式服务运行指南
本文详细介绍了如何在Docker环境中搭建Consul集群,并基于该集群运行分布式服务。内容涵盖Consul镜像构建、多主机集群部署、节点引导与加入、服务注册与发现、DNS解析测试等关键步骤,同时提供了分布式应用程序和客户端的构建与运行方法,以及常见问题的解决方案,帮助开发者实现高可用、可扩展的分布式系统架构。原创 2025-09-28 15:12:29 · 30 阅读 · 0 评论 -
13、Docker编排与服务发现指南
本文详细介绍了如何使用Docker Compose进行容器编排,并结合Consul实现分布式环境下的服务发现与管理。内容涵盖Docker Compose的安装与配置、示例应用的构建与运行、服务注册与查询、健康检查机制以及Consul集群的高可用和故障转移能力。通过实际操作步骤和流程图,帮助开发者掌握构建弹性、可扩展的微服务架构的关键技术,为现代分布式应用的部署与运维提供完整解决方案。原创 2025-09-27 16:57:20 · 34 阅读 · 0 评论 -
12、使用 Docker 构建服务及容器编排指南
本文详细介绍了如何使用Docker构建多容器应用栈,涵盖Redis主从镜像构建、Redis集群部署、Node.js应用容器化、日志收集(Logstash)等核心环节。同时深入讲解了三大容器编排工具:Docker Compose、Consul和Swarm的原理与实践,帮助开发者掌握现代微服务架构下的容器化部署与管理方法。原创 2025-09-26 13:46:45 · 34 阅读 · 0 评论 -
11、使用 Docker 构建服务
本文详细介绍了如何使用Docker构建多种类型的服务,包括Jekyll静态网站、Java应用服务器以及基于Node.js和Redis的多容器应用栈。通过实际操作示例,展示了服务的构建、更新、备份与扩展方法,并涵盖了卷管理、容器链接、镜像构建等核心概念。文章还演示了如何实现Redis主从复制和集中式日志管理,体现了Docker在高可用、可扩展应用部署中的强大能力,适用于Web应用、分布式系统等多种场景。原创 2025-09-25 10:12:02 · 20 阅读 · 0 评论 -
10、Docker在测试与服务构建中的应用实践
本文详细介绍了Docker在测试与服务构建中的应用实践。涵盖使用Jenkins进行自动化测试,包括单任务与多配置任务的创建与执行;通过Docker构建Jekyll静态站点和Apache服务镜像,利用卷实现容器间数据共享;并总结了操作流程与技术要点。文章还探讨了Docker在多语言支持、分布式系统及CI/CD中的拓展应用,展望了其在智能运维与容器编排中的未来发展方向。原创 2025-09-24 16:03:37 · 30 阅读 · 0 评论 -
9、使用 Docker 进行测试与持续集成
本文介绍了如何使用 Docker 进行测试与持续集成。首先解决了容器重启后 IP 变更导致服务无法连接的问题,通过 Docker 自定义网络实现容器间的安全通信,并以 Sinatra 和 Redis 应用为例演示了容器互联的实践。随后,构建集成了 Jenkins 和 Docker 的持续集成环境,详细解析了自动化测试脚本和测试用 Dockerfile 的作用。文章还探讨了持续集成的优势、适用场景及安全、资源管理等方面的最佳实践,帮助开发者高效构建、测试和部署应用。原创 2025-09-23 11:15:54 · 47 阅读 · 0 评论 -
8、使用 Docker 进行测试与应用开发
本文详细介绍了如何使用 Docker 进行 Web 应用的测试与开发,涵盖基于 Nginx 的静态网站测试、Sinatra 动态应用构建以及集成 Redis 实现数据存储。深入讲解了容器卷挂载、端口映射、Docker 内部网络与现代 Docker 网络的区别与配置,并提供了常见问题排查方法和最佳实践建议,帮助开发者高效利用 Docker 提升开发部署效率。原创 2025-09-22 10:37:53 · 20 阅读 · 0 评论 -
7、Docker 镜像与仓库使用及测试实践
本文详细介绍了Docker在镜像管理、仓库使用、静态网站与Web应用测试以及持续集成中的实践方法。涵盖推送镜像到Docker Hub、配置自动化构建、运行私有注册表、构建Nginx和Flask应用镜像,并结合Jenkins实现CI流程,帮助开发者高效利用Docker提升开发部署一致性与效率。原创 2025-09-21 10:40:21 · 20 阅读 · 0 评论 -
6、Docker 镜像构建与管理全解析
本文全面解析了Docker镜像的构建与管理过程,涵盖从Dockerfile编写、镜像构建、容器启动到端口映射等核心操作。详细介绍了常用Dockerfile指令如CMD、ENTRYPOINT、ENV、VOLUME、COPY、ADD等的功能与使用场景,并通过实际示例展示如何构建Node.js应用镜像。同时讲解了构建缓存优化、模板化构建、调试技巧及常见问题解决方案,帮助开发者高效利用Docker进行应用部署和维护。原创 2025-09-20 13:58:51 · 40 阅读 · 0 评论 -
5、Docker 镜像与仓库使用指南
本文详细介绍了Docker镜像与仓库的使用方法,涵盖镜像的分层结构、本地查看与搜索、从Docker Hub拉取镜像等基础操作。重点讲解了通过docker commit和Dockerfile两种方式构建自定义镜像,并推荐使用Dockerfile实现可重复、透明的镜像构建。同时探讨了基础镜像选择、镜像分层优化、标签管理、安全检查等最佳实践,以及如何将镜像推送到Docker Hub并实现跨主机部署。全文结合命令示例与流程图,帮助读者系统掌握Docker镜像的全生命周期管理。原创 2025-09-19 09:58:49 · 38 阅读 · 0 评论 -
4、Docker 容器与镜像使用指南
本文详细介绍了Docker容器与镜像的基础操作与核心概念。内容涵盖容器的命名、启动、连接、停止与删除,以及守护式容器的创建与管理;深入解析了Docker镜像的分层结构及其优势,包括存储优化、构建效率和分发便利;同时讲解了镜像的列出、拉取、删除操作,以及如何使用Docker Hub和搭建私有注册表进行镜像管理。最后分享了镜像构建的最佳实践,帮助开发者高效、规范地使用Docker进行应用部署与运维。原创 2025-09-18 10:16:20 · 21 阅读 · 0 评论 -
3、Docker入门指南
本文是一篇全面的Docker入门指南,涵盖了Docker在Windows和Linux系统上的安装方法、Docker守护进程的管理与配置、容器的创建与基本操作。同时详细介绍了容器的生命周期管理、镜像的查看与删除、多种网络模式的应用以及数据卷的创建与挂载。通过本指南,读者可以快速掌握Docker的核心概念与常用命令,为后续深入学习和实践打下坚实基础。原创 2025-09-17 16:34:28 · 19 阅读 · 0 评论 -
2、Docker安装全攻略
本文详细介绍了在多种操作系统上安装Docker的完整流程,涵盖Ubuntu、Debian、Red Hat及其衍生发行版(如CentOS、Fedora)、OS X和Microsoft Windows。内容包括Docker的核心技术组件、安装前提条件、各系统具体安装步骤及验证方法,并提供了清晰的流程图和总结表格,帮助用户根据自身环境快速部署Docker,开启容器化应用开发与管理之旅。原创 2025-09-16 16:02:53 · 26 阅读 · 0 评论 -
1、Docker:容器化技术的革新力量
本文深入探讨了Docker作为容器化技术的革新力量,涵盖其适用人群、核心组件、技术优势与挑战,并对比了Docker与传统虚拟化技术的差异。文章介绍了Docker在开发、测试和生产环境中的广泛应用场景,展示了如何使用Docker构建和运行应用的具体步骤,并展望了其与新兴技术融合的未来发展趋势,为开发者和运维人员提供了全面的Docker技术导览。原创 2025-09-15 12:18:22 · 36 阅读 · 0 评论
分享